<h2>Clothing & Accessories</h2> <ol> <li>Comfortable and stylish outfits for exploring, boating, and partying</li> <li>Swimwear for beach activities and houseboat experience</li> <li>Light jacket or shawl for the cooler evening in Munnar</li> <li>Comfortable shoes for walking and beach volleyball</li> <li>Sunglasses and hat for sun protection</li> </ol> <h2>Toiletries</h2> <ol> <li>Sunscreen and after-sun lotion</li> <li>Insect repellent</li> <li>Toothbrush, toothpaste, and floss</li> <li>Shampoo, conditioner, and body wash</li> <li>Deodorant</li> </ol> <h2>Health & Medications</h2> <ol> <li>First-aid kit with basic medical supplies</li> <li>Pain relievers and allergy medication</li> <li>Prescription medications, if applicable</li> <li>Hand sanitizer</li> <li>Reusable water bottle for staying hydrated</li> </ol> <h2>Electronics & Gadgets</h2> <ol> <li>Smartphone for communication and navigation</li> <li>Portable charger/power bank</li> <li>Waterproof camera for capturing beach and boating moments</li> <li>Travel adapter for charging devices</li> <li>Bluetooth speaker for beachside party</li> </ol> <h2>Travel Documents & Essentials</h2> <ol> <li>Passport, visa, and any other necessary travel documents</li> <li>Cash and credit/debit cards</li> <li>Travel insurance details</li> <li>Copies of important documents (stored electronically and in print)</li> <li>Local emergency contact information</li> </ol> <h2>Miscellaneous</h2> <ol> <li>Beach towel or sarong</li> <li>Beach games equipment (volleyball, frisbee, etc.)</li> <li>Portable cooler for keeping drinks cold</li> <li>Party decorations and accessories for the private beachside celebration</li> <li>Small backpack or tote for day trips and boating</li> </ol> <h3>Tips and General Clothing Customs</h3> <p>While packing for Kerala, it's important to consider the cultural norms and weather. Kerala has a tropical climate, so lightweight, breathable clothing is essential. However, modesty is also valued, especially in more traditional areas. For the party and beach activities, casual and trendy outfits are appropriate, but for visiting religious sites or local communities, it's best to opt for more conservative attire. Additionally, it's customary to remove shoes before entering homes and religious places, so slip-on shoes or sandals are convenient.</p>
